The 3 months correlation between Franklin and Transamerica is 0.69.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Franklin Small Cap and Transamerica Large Cap in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Transamerica Large Cap and Franklin Small is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Franklin Small Cap are associated (or correlated) with Transamerica Large. Pair Trading with Franklin Small and Transamerica Large
The main advantage of trading using opposite Franklin Small and Transamerica Large posit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Franklin Small position performs unexpectedly, Transamerica Large can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
